Moody, Floydian Celtic-tinged Rock

Mostly Autumn are a seven piece band from York and have been formed for over nine years playing music that has been described as organic emotionally charged rock with Celtic undertones. They are hailed as the band rock fans have been waiting twenty years for. The amazing seven-piece have all the hallmarks of the great bands from the seventies – there are echoes of Pink Floyd, Jethro Tull, Genesis and all of the greats, but the sound is unmistakably their own.

Like the Autumn season itself, their music has a romantic, organic quality and are a rare naturalness, but it also combines elements of sheer power and intensity. The songs seem to grow into life rather than emerge as the work of a laboured writing process.

They have recently won "best band", "best track", best classic rock gig", "best guitarist", and "best vocalist" in the international "Classic Rock Society" awards, voted for by the public.

After signing a major record deal worth over 1.2 million with "Classic Rock Productions" two years ago they have repeatedly played sold out concerts in Germany, Holland, Belgium, France, Spain, Norway, New Jersey, Mexico and all over the U.K.

After an amazing 3 years with Classic Rock Productions, both parties decided that Mostly Autumn should be set free and on 4th June 2005 The New Astoria, London saw the launch of Mostly Autumn Records, and a live recording of this gig 'Storms over London Town' was released early this year.  They are currently writing and recording their latest (6th) studio album 'Heart full of Sky' which will be on general release next February 2007.  A limited edition double album is available to pre-order now and will be pressed late November or early December this year.
